Two-dimensional echocardiographic assessment of dextrocardia: a segmental approach.

作者信息

Huhta J C, Hagler D J, Seward J B, Tajik A J, Julsrud P R, Ritter D G

出版信息

Am J Cardiol. 1982 Dec;50(6):1351-60. doi: 10.1016/0002-9149(82)90474-x.

Abstract

Two-dimensional echocardiography was used in the prospective evaluation of 40 patients with the clinical diagnosis of dextrocardia. A segmental analysis of the situs, connections, ventricular anatomy, and chamber positions was utilized for a complete diagnostic assessment. An adequate examination was possible in 33 of these patients; the findings were confirmed by cardiac catheterization and angiography in 31 patients and at operation in 26. Use of the location of the liver and the drainage of the hepatic veins and inferior vena cava allowed atrial visceral situs to be defined in 33 patients (solitus 21, inversus 9, and ambiguous 3). Pulmonary venous connections were correctly identified in 27. In 33 patients, atrioventricular (AV) and ventriculoarterial connections and ventricular anatomy were correctly predicted. Twenty patients had 2 separate well-developed ventricles. Ventriculoarterial connections were determined correctly in all 20 patients: concordant in 5, discordant in 6, double-outlet right ventricle in 5, and single-outlet right ventricle (pulmonary atresia) in 4. In 16 patients a ventricular septal defect was correctly identified. In the remainder the ventricular septum was intact. Thirteen patients had univentricular heart: 8 had 2 AV valves (double-inlet ventricle) 3 had common AV inlet, and 2 had atresia of 1 AV connection. Two-dimensional echocardiography allowed the accurate assessment of complex congenital heart defects associated with dextrocardia. Utilizing a segmental approach, one can correctly predict atrial-visceral situs, ventricular morphology and situs, and AV and ventriculoarterial connections.

摘要

二维超声心动图用于对40例临床诊断为右位心的患者进行前瞻性评估。采用对心脏位置、连接、心室解剖结构和心腔位置的节段性分析进行全面的诊断评估。其中33例患者能够进行充分检查;31例患者经心导管检查和血管造影证实了检查结果,26例患者经手术证实。通过肝脏位置以及肝静脉和下腔静脉的引流情况,确定了33例患者的心房内脏位置(正位21例、反位9例、不明确3例)。正确识别了27例患者的肺静脉连接情况。在33例患者中,正确预测了房室(AV)和心室动脉连接以及心室解剖结构。20例患者有两个独立且发育良好的心室。所有20例患者的心室动脉连接均被正确确定:一致连接5例、不一致连接6例、右心室双出口5例、单出口右心室(肺动脉闭锁)4例。16例患者正确识别出室间隔缺损。其余患者室间隔完整。13例患者为单心室心脏:8例有两个房室瓣(双入口心室),3例有共同房室入口,2例有一个房室连接闭锁。二维超声心动图能够准确评估与右位心相关的复杂先天性心脏缺陷。采用节段性方法,可以正确预测心房内脏位置、心室形态和位置以及房室和心室动脉连接。
